Seals

Window seals are an essential component of your windows, helping to prevent drafts and moisture from entering your home. They also assist in reducing sound. If you have double- or triple-pane windows, regular fogging between the panes usually indicates a damaged thermal seal. Repairing this can cost between $100 and $200, and involves removing one of the panes applying a chemical between the panes to eliminate the condensation, then replacing the seal.

Screens

Window screens are a vital part of your home. They keeps out pests while allowing air to circulate. They also shield your interior from dandelion puffs, pollen and claws from pets. If they're damaged or damaged, it's crucial to call a handyman for screen repair or replacement as soon as possible.

Screens can be made from aluminum, fiberglass or copper-bronze. Fiberglass is the least expensive option, while bronze and aluminum offer more durability and endurance. These are great options for people in harsh climates, since they are resistant to corrosion and withstand weathering.

Security screens are a type of window screen that's made to provide additional protection against break-ins, forced entry and forced entry. They resemble normal screens, however they're constructed with stronger mesh that is more difficult to cut or cut through. They are also difficult to remove since they can be inserted into frame of the door or window. They are typically employed in homes where there are pets or children due to their added safety. Although they're more expensive than regular window screens, the peace of mind they offer is worth the expense.

Sash cords

Sash cords regulate the movement of sash windows. The cords are housed in channels behind the beadings and connected to weights that rest on a pulley wheels sited at the top of the frame. The weights are used to ensure that the sashes are balanced and make it easier to open and close them. As time passes, they could be damaged or frayed. Fortunately, the cost of replacing them is not too high.

You can find replacements at hardware stores and home improvement shops. Buffalo and Samson are two of the many types of sash cords that are available. Buffalo is softer and simpler to cut than Samson. Make use of a sharp utility blade to cut along any joints in the paint, and gently pry out the pockets. You can also use a screwdriver to remove any screws or nails that hold the pockets in place.

Window wells

Window wells let air and sunlight into basements, and they are an escape route in times of emergency. They should be inspected and maintained regularly. If left unattended, they may get blocked by debris and cause water leaks into the basement. Additionally, they could be a safety hazard for children and pets.

A damaged or rusted well could mean that it's time to replace the window. This is particularly important when you're a parent of young children. Even the child who is being watched may get caught in the window and get injured. A liability lawsuit could be filed, and there would be a huge amount of damages.

To install a new window you must purchase one that is in line with the dimensions of your house. There are many options available that include fiberglass, steel and concrete, as well as different colors and designs. To secure the well, you'll also need drainage gravel, as well as wall anchors. Contact 811 prior to starting the project to mark all utility lines that are underground. Wear protective clothing and eyewear while working.

Scratches

From a frightened cat that needs claw trims to tree branches that rub against your house, small scratches can show up on the glass of your windows that can be ugly and hard to see. They're not permanent however, and can be fixed with the appropriate DIY methods.

You'll need to ensure that the surface of the scratch is clean and dry before you attempt to remove it. To do this, use a clean, dry cloth that won't scratch the window and is free of lint. You can make use of a microfiber cloth or a coffee filter as they're both water-resistant and lint free.

You can get rid of a small scratch with toothpaste. Apply a small amount to the glass and rub in a circular movement. The mild abrasive found in toothpaste can reduce the appearance of the scratch. It is possible to get a professional's help when you have a large scratch or one that is more noticeable. They can use progressively finer grits in order to polish the windows again.

Condensation

Condensation could damage your windows and even your home. It can cause damage to the glass but also harms frames and molding. Mold, water leaks, and other serious issues can be caused by excessive condensation.

Window condensation occurs when humid, warm air comes into contact with a cold surface, such as glass or metal. It's an natural phenomenon that can occur in any location however it's more likely to happen in homes that have high humidity and rapid temperature fluctuations. It's most prevalent in the spring, summer and autumn, when cool nights follow warm days.

If condensation develops between the panes of a triple- or double-paned window, it's typically a sign of a seal failure. A window repairman can reseal the insulating air space in these types of windows to stop moisture intrusion.
